Appointment | Akshay Bhardwaj joins Andaz Delhi as new Head Chef

With a culinary experience of more than a decade, Bhardwaj is an MBA in Hospitality and International Tourism

Andaz Delhi has a new Head Chef- Akshay Bhardwaj. With a culinary experience of more than a decade, Bhardwaj has worked with some of the industry's most well-known names. In July 2008, he began his career in hospitality with ISTA 5 star Luxury Hotels. Over the next few years, he interned at Le Chatelain Hotel in Brussels, Wildflower Hall in Shimla, Hotel Vatel in Nimes, France, and Le Bateau Ivre (a 2 star Michelin Star Restaurant) under celebrity chef Jean Pierre Jacob. As Demi Chef de Partie, he joined Oceania Cruises, an upper-tier cruise line, in 2011. 

In 2012, he moved to India to work as a Chef de Partie at Pullman Hotels, and in April 2013, he relocated to Canada to work in the same capacity at Sawridge Hotels Alberta. He worked in Canada and Denmark for the next three years before returning to India in August 2016 as the Executive Chef for the pre-opening of Whisky Samba in Gurgaon. He was promoted to Corporate Chef at Eastman Colour Restaurants Pvt. Ltd. two years later (La Roca, Aerocity and Unplugged Courtyard in Connaught Place and Gurgaon). His most recent position was as Executive Sous Chef at the ITC Maurya in Delhi.

Hilton News | Hilton makes key sharing easier as it pushes connecting rooms

Hilton has unveiled a range of new technologies as it looks to push the boat out on the guest experience. In its latest initiative, it is allowing guests to share their room keys digitally. A move that goes hand in hand with the group’s renewed focus on selling connecting rooms.

The new digital key share allows one guest to give room access to up to four other guests through the Hilton Honors App. Since its 2015 launch, Hilton’s Digital Key has expanded rapidly. The technology is now available at more than 80 percent of Hilton’s portfolio. That’s close to 5,400 of Hilton’s more than 6,600 properties worldwide. It has been used to open more than 135 million guestroom doors and has reduced plastic waste by 125 tonnes.

NEWS | 3rd edition of DPIIT – ASCON Consultation Forum

Jyoti Mayal, President, TAAI and Member Board – CII National Committee on Tourism and Hospitality represented Travel Trade Fraternity at the 3rd edition of DPIIT – ASCON Consultation Forum with Industry Associations’ theme “Stimulating Growth for Aatmanirbhar Bharat -Leveraging Opportunities Post Pandemic” on 9 October 2021 which was jointly organized by ASCON, CII, and supported by DPIIT, Government of India. The meeting was presided over by the Hon’ble Minister of Commerce and Industry, Shri. Piyush Goyal. 

 

TAAI has actively participated & submitted its inputs and supported CII’s National Tourism Councils perspective, to the Government of India. Tourism is a significant sector & contributes 9% to the GDP of our country & nearly equal in employment.

 

The Six key recommendations were collated into a presentation under Investments, Cost of doing business, Ease of doing business, Trade Policy, Technology & R&D & Job creation & Skills. These were put forth to Shri. Piyush Goyal, Hon’ble Minister of Commerce & Industry, Textiles, Consumer Affairs, Food and Public Distribution during the report-back session.

 

Sharing some of the key recommendations by the entire committee. 

 

  • Inclusion of Tourism in Concurrent list. The National Tourism Policy has had multiple deliberations, but a revised policy is still awaited.

  • Waiver of statutory dues and licenses. ECLGS 5.0 for disbursing another 20% on outstanding loans.

  • Govt. to restore SEIS to 7% for travel and 5% for hotels & to restore without legal entity wise capping of 5 crores.

  • Auto-renewal of licenses without any fees for this financial year.

  • Enabling investments in the industry in a time-bound manner through single-window clearances.

  • Promote travel spending LTA Tax Exemption and Allow a 200 per cent weighted exemption. Need of National Tourism Fund to be created.

  • An empowered Taskforce to be created with members from the Industry, Ministry of Commerce, Tourism, Environment, Shipping, Civil Aviation and Culture.

  • To restart scheduled international flights in tandem with tourist visas to stimulate inbound tourism & necessary provision to be made in the new Foreign Trade Policy 2021-26 for custom duty waiver.

  • Opening up tourism by starting e-visa, through Vaccine certificates & promoting India as a Safe Tourist Destination. Campaigns to attract young talent.

  • Skill Development and Training in Public-Private Partnerships (PPP). Travel agents to be reskilled through certified courses. TTT courses. Endorsement/certification by Government. Rebates to be given for investments in skilling.

Eclat Insights | The Forgetting Curve, What It Is, Why It Matters & What To Do

eclat+insights+for+hospitality+leaders.png

The forgetting curve hypothesizes the decline of memory retention in time. This curve shows how information is lost over time when there is no attempt to retain it.

Why is it relevant to you?

For yourself, use these insights to develop a system to fight the forgetting curve. If you lead a team, then bake this into your processes.

Actionable Insights

The key here is to retain the knowledge. Start with acceptance. Just because you saw a product demo once or you had a lecture or training program, does not mean you will retain that knowledge and neither will your team.

  • You have to put in a process to consciously review the learned knowledge.

Simply put, you should make sure you review regularly to make learning stick.

Find out more about spaced repetition - A Simple yet powerful methodology to learn and retain knowledge using flashcards. There are tons of apps too.

Real-World Examples

For Chefs / Kitchen Teams - When trying to share, teach a new recipe to the team.

  1. Ask your team to read a recipe.

  2. Do a demo of the recipe the next day. Take pics or make a video.

  3. Have a discussion on the recipe, dish, the next day.

  4. Ensure there is a review: 3 days, 7 days and 21 days from the first time the recipe was demonstrated.

  5. Use the pics or video for the review. Ask questions. Take a quiz.

  6. Do a repeat demo if the team is unable to remember details.

For Front Office Service Leaders / Food & Beverage Service Leaders

You can use an electronic version or pen & paper.

  1. For your regulars or repeat guests, make cards with their names on one side and details on the opposite side. These could be preferences, standing instructions etc

  2. Get each team member to start with one card from the stack. If they are able to answer correctly the card moves to a box they need to see only after 21 days. If not, they need to see it again the next day.

  3. Do this, till you are out of cards.

You can use the same methodology for any knowledge across any team.

Want to make this WOW?

  • Reward people for remembering stuff.

  • Allow people time on shift to do this.

  • Start small. Make a deck of just 10 cards with the most important things you want your team or yourself to remember. Once you ace these 10 cards you will know the power of the method. Expand as & when required.

New Opening | Meliá to Open on Thailand’s Mai Khao Beach

Meliá Phuket Mai Khao, a 30-suite and 70-villa resort on eight acres of Phuket’s northwestern coastline overlooking the sky-blue Andaman Sea is slated to open in December.

Meliá to Open on Thailand’s Mai Khao Beach

Leading Spanish hotel group partners with Phuket Villa Group to launch landmark resort

PHUKET, Thailand (Oct. 14, 2021) – Meliá Phuket Mai Khao, a 30-suite and 70-villa resort on eight acres of Phuket’s northwestern coastline overlooking the sky-blue Andaman Sea is slated to open in December.

Fronting Phuket’s longest stretch of sand, the resort on Mai Khao Beach is close to an array of attractions such as Sirinat National Park, Mai Khao Marine Turtle Foundation, and Wat Phra Thong temple. Phuket International Airport is a 15-minute drive.

Authorities plan to open Thailand to fully vaccinated tourists from countries deemed low-risk from November 1.

Launched by Meliá Hotels International and owned by Thailand’s leading residential real estate developer Phuket Villa Group, the five-star resort is part of a roll-out of the Meliá brand in key destinations across Thailand including Koh Samui, Chiang Mai and Bangkok.

The new resort’s saltwater swimming pools, private villa pools, a reflection pond with sunken seating areas, water gardens, vertical falls and irrigation mist evoke a restorative atmosphere. The overarching design pays tribute to contemporary aesthetics and traditional Thai touches.

The contemporary, light-filled and spacious Mediterranean-inspired accommodations comprise 30 one-bedroom suites and 70 one-bedroom villas that each cater for up to two adults and two children. All feature outdoor bathtubs, open-air showers and vast outdoor terraces.

The 78sqm suites are complemented by cabanas and the 85sqm one-bedroom villas have private plunge pools. Fifteen “wellness villas” feature an open-air Vitamin C shower, daily massage, ultrasonic essential oil diffuser, GermGuardian air purifier, Tempur-Pedic pillows, fit ball and yoga mat.

Meliá Phuket Mai Khao will explore a diverse culinary landscape from four outlets. Near the beach pool with its cabanas and sun lounges, chic Gaia Beach Club is “the place to be”. Drawing on Meliá’s Spanish origins, Gaia celebrates Spain’s famed gastronomy by serving Mediterranean and fusion cuisine from an open kitchen and an imaginative cocktail selection from a long bar.

Elegant all-day dining restaurant SASA specialises in Southeast Asian cuisine. A warm and intimate setting adorned with timber finishes, SASA offers casual fine dining by night. Elyxr Café serves freshly squeezed juices and locally brewed liquors.

Shaded by a broad spectrum of native plants, the resort's design deploys a neutral palette of colours as a complement to Mai Khao’s sandy shore. Its high ceilings, floor-to-roof glass panels and decorative metal screens take advantage of the natural surrounds and abundance of sunshine.

At 300sqm, Meliá’s signature YHI Spa is home to five treatment rooms. In addition to its extensive menu of massages, facials, body scrubs and wraps, spa therapists also provide poolside and in-villa treatments.

The fitness center is equipped with treadmills, ellipticals, exercise bikes, and weights machines. The kids club Kidsdom has workshops to keep youngsters entertained.

An idyllic venue for weddings and events, the resort’s conference facilities include a grand ballroom and two additional multi-function rooms. The resort’s event planners offer customized catering and mini mindfulness sessions.

Maldives News | Dusit Thani Maldives Opens Sustainable Chef’s Garden Emphasizing Locally Grown, Fresh Produce

Dusit Thani Maldives, a luxury resort on Mudhdhoo Island in Baa Atoll, has further committed to its CSR and sustainable pledges by opening a carefully constructed Chef’s Garden growing a bounty of fresh ingredients for its award-winning restaurants.  

Designed and built by gardener Mr Ramesh Khadka alongside Executive Chef Richard Thompson, the raised-bed construction was selected for its many advantages over a ground- based garden, including the need for approximately 50% less soil.  

Gardner, Mr Ramesh Khadka

The beds are built from styrofoam boxes, which retain moisture and enable gardeners to reduce watering by up to 60%. The elevated height of the beds prevents local trees from inserting feeler shoots and hijacking nutrients from the budding produce, the variety of which can be expanded with a quick turnaround after each harvest.  

The garden ensures Chef Thompson will have direct access to nutritious fresh ingredients such as tomatoes, corn, peppers, Chinese cabbage, aubergine, pak choi and cucumber; a plethora of herbs like rosemary, Greek oregano, coriander and mint; and flavourful additions including Thai chillies, local chillies and lemongrass, which will take a starring role in the Royal Thai cuisine at Benjarong restaurant.  

Besides the garden, a high production hydroponics system features 218 cups for growing leafy vegetables and requires only 500 litres of water every eight weeks. Chef Thompson was inspired to work with the engineering team to build the beds and even craft the hydroponic cups.  

“I’m so excited for all our guests to have the chance to visit and personally see our beautiful garden,” he said. “We’re also in the process of setting up a deep culture system to maximise our limited space and grow even larger varieties of vegetables.”  

On October 16, guests and visitors will have the opportunity to explore the garden when the resort celebrates World Food Day. Participants will be invited to learn more about the produce, the hydroponic structure, how it functions, and the reasons behind its construction. With guidance from Chef Thomspon, they will also be able to harvest fresh leaves and vegetables and take part in a tasting of homemade bruschetta.

NEWS | Mumbai Central gets 48 Japanese-style 'pod hotels' for train travellers

Taking passenger comfort a notch higher, the railways has readied 48 sleeping pods or capsules at Mumbai Central station for rail users. They will be launched by the end of this month.

Of the pods, 30 have been tagged as ‘classic’, seven marked for women, 10 private and one for the differently abled. Located on the first floor of the station building, the pod room is spread over 3,000 sq ft. The cheapest pod will cost INR 999 for 12 hours.

“This unique facility will be a gamechanger in the way passengers travel in India by rail, especially those on business trips. The concept will best suit frequent travellers, backpackers, single travellers, corporate executives and study groups,” said a senior IRCTC official.

First popularised by Japan, a pod hotel features a large number of small bed-sized rooms. These hotels provide basic overnight accommodation for guests who do not require or cannot afford larger, more expensive rooms at conventional hotels. “A pod hotel is compact, packed full of comfortable design, attractive features and competitively priced. The beauty of the space is the absence of excess,” an official said.

Each pod user will have access to free Wi-Fi, luggage room, toiletries, shower rooms, washrooms in common areas, whereas inside the pod the guest can avail facilities like TV, a small locker, mirror, adjustable air conditioner and air filter vents, reading lights apart from interior light, mobile charging, smoke detectors and DND Indicators.

Explaining the categories, an official said, “While classic and ladies pods will comfortably fit for one guest, a private pod will also have a private space within the room, whereas the room for the differently abled will comfortably fit two guests with space for free wheelchair movement.”
